The Department of Justice's Civil Division filed complaints against Massachusetts and Rhode Island, challenging state laws that provide in-state tuition and financial assistance to undocumented immigrants. The DOJ argues these laws unconstitutionally discriminate against U.S. citizens, incentivize illegal immigration, and conflict with federal law.
